Responsibilities:

Parts Manager: 

• Forecasting parts needs and ordering parts to maintain optimal inventory levels

• Monitoring the current parts inventory

• Pricing parts to maintain profitability

• Receiving parts, including placing them into inventory and properly labeling them

• Helping customers find and purchase the correct parts

• Overseeing special orders

• Collaborating with service managers to ensure all parts are available for repair jobs

• Hiring, supervising and training parts department staff members

Other duties as assigned

Qualifications:

Parts Manager: 

• Sales and customer service skills if working with the general public

• Strong written and verbal communication skills

• Mathematical skills to help manage the inventory, pricing and estimates

• Problem-solving skills to deal with parts inventory issues

• Previous mechanic or car sales experience

• Ability to work in a fast-paced and sometimes loud environment

• Leadership skills to keep the parts department running smoothly

• Product knowledge to ensure they identify parts correctly and recommend the needed parts
